Residents in Port St Mary spent last night back in their own beds, after Monday evening's evacuation because of the huge landslide at Happy Valley.
Businesses in the immediate area were reopened yesterday and people living in twelve properties were allowed back home, after engineers made sure they were safe to return to.
Meanwhile, investigations are continuing into why why more than 50 tonnes of earth and stone slid from underneath Bay View Road down towards the beach.
